Speculation dangers fade

Published on 2 August 2010 at 09:42

Cover

"The latest economic figures are chasing away the sharks", rejoicesPúblico. The left-leaning daily explains that "general transparency and the stress tests have quelled the panic in the markets" and that "the majority (of hedge funds) have curbed their speculation against Spanish companies". The improvement of the risk premium, along with rising stock market results, which climbed 13.5% in July, and an increase in available liquidity confirm "that comparison with Greece was greatly exaggerated", the paper concludes.
